During the 19th Century, one scholar with the name of Edwin Abbott, tried to explain what it would be the Fourth Dimension (The Invisible Universe) in a world called Flatland of only Two Dimensions (left-right). Its habitants could have several forms, such as squares and triangles but they would not perceive each other that way as they could not see more than one side at a time, like for instance, when they would be walking around each other. If someone from our three-dimensional world would meet with someone of the four-dimension's one, we could only have a limited contact with such visitor. We could say that in our three-dimensional world the visitor could appear and disappear, could change its form, enter in a locked room through walls or closed doors and suddenly, to reappear in front of someone else far away from us. It is interesting to remind that, exactly, those are the powers connected to angels by the philosophers of the Middle-Age, before anyone could think about the existence of a fourth-dimension.

NEPAL is in the map again. NEPAL is back in popularity as a destination of the world as it has been before, when the young people invaded it in the decade of the 1950’s in search of love and peace. Now, old and new Buddhists are returning as this site of peace and friendship has its doors open to all those ones followers of Bo Tibetan Buddhism and their head, His Holy Highness, the Dalai Lama. NEPAL is the site of many Tibetan refugees and besides that, it counts with Lumbini in its terrains, the site where Lord Buddha was born. From all places these faithful Buddhists are arriving here, to this country, for the healing of the soul, for meditation and for obtaining the serenity needed to clear and clean the minds from the dirt and pollution –in all the extension of its meaning- of the outer rushing world. Many of these followers are getting peregrinations fixed from Kathmandu, to Lumbini and from there to Patna and Varanasi (Sarnath) in India so to make their Holy-Buddhist-Triangle first, and then, to close the circle when returning to Kathmandu, known in the 17th Century as Kantipur, or the site of the Kasthmandap Pagoda.
And NEPAL is not only offering a healing for the soul, but also healings for the body and so it may be contacted for Ayurvedics and Yoga within many other forms against ails and sufferings.
 
NEPAL is also the country for scenic trekking and for one of the Magnus opus routes for climbing: that one of the mighty Mt. Everest. In his grounds, NEPAL contains 08 Himalayan peaks of more than eight thousand meters high (+8.720 feet). Adding up all these heights, 66.455 meters (72,425.05 feet), it makes the higher steps in the world to reach Heaven. Such steps make the man-made ziggurats of Mesopotamia and Babylon to pale in comparison with such magnificence. Indeed, with such steps it is easier for the supreme to visit Earth and that is why I am sure, we, particularly, encounter with so many gods in this country.
 
NEPAL is one of the world’s most important Cradles of Art. Their Newaris, have mastered, -indeed mastered-, such arts and crafts for centuries and their work is found, not only all around Nepal itself but also, very specially, within all the Tibetan Plateau, inside and outside the monasteries, stupas, pagodas and temples.
